I had my surgery on Wednesday and I came home Friday evening. I'm already bored with Water, apple juice, popsicles and broth. I am on liquids until my first doctor visit on Thursday, please any suggestions?

View consumption of food/nutrition as a prescription... at this phase it really isnt about enjoyment. good news is that later, it gets much better!

I am surprised you aren't on Protein drinks. AS soon as I was cleared for "full liquids" it was Water and Protein Drinks. The trick I was given was to serve them in a shot glass...haha.. with a goal to down a shot every 30 minutes!

If your surgeon wants you on "clear liquids" maybe you can try Isopure Protein drinks which are clear and will give you 40 grams of protein in 20 oz. In the end go with your surgeon's recommendations.
